--- Begin Forwarded Message --- Date: Sat, 22 May 1999 19:48:20 -0500 From: "Hjelmfelt Jr, Allen T." <[log in to unmask]> Subject: RE: <no subject> <fwd> Sender: "Hjelmfelt Jr, Allen T." <[log in to unmask]> Nat Case John Reps, Cities of the Mississippi, Univ. Missouri Press, 1994 covers part of your description. It contains text, one or more 19th century birdseye views of the cities and modern aerial photographs by Alex MacLean, which try to match the view point of the 19th century artist. An exceptionally interesting book. Unfortunately, St. Cloud is as close as he gets to Canada.
